> Actually, I believe my problem may be with the pattern that I'm using.  I'm
> using facets, and after checking the documentation I haven't found a way to
> increase the intensity of the facets for a normal.
> 
> I'm trying to have a texture that has large facets, but with smaller facets
> between.  So I averaged a large facet normal and small facet normal, but in
> the result the facets are so faint you can hardly see either of them.
> 
> 
> 
> 
Try increasing the ponderation factor for the large patern.
normal_map{[2 facets][1facets scale 0.1]}
This will double the weight of the large scale pattern.
